Possible to get a 2nd US Passport expedited on a walk-in?

In NYC. Say I walk in to the passport office branch, can I request they expedite a request for a 2nd passport. I don't need to use the second passport until August, but will be out of the country from May until I need to use the second passport. Also, what sort of documentation and materials will I need to bring with me? This is for a 2-year validity second passport, which in this case is to ease the headaches involved in traveling between Israel and certain Arab countries that won't let you in with an Israeli stamp. Absolutely doable. Call the passport hotline and then will explain the different criteria under which you can get one and will give you the exact language you need to write in your application for approval. If you can goto the passport office they should be able to turn it around in a day, a few more if you need to mail it.

You can enter and exit Israel without them stamping your passport. I did. They stamp a piece of paper. There is absolutely no evidence in my passport that I ever visited Israel.

They do the same when I visit the Turkish-occupied part of Cyprus.

I picked up a 2nd passport in San Diego last week. Piece of cake. Dropped off my existing passport, along with the letter of explanation and copies of my flight itineraries, then returned the next day to pick up my 2nd passport. Just make sure you get your letter right. Cost is $170 at the walk-in locations.
